Before diving into their evolution, let’s clarify what webhooks are. At their core, webhooks are user-defined HTTP callbacks that allow one application to send real-time data to another whenever a specific event occurs. Unlike traditional APIs, which require constant polling to check for updates, webhooks push data automatically, making them faster, more efficient, and less resource-intensive.
For example, when you receive a notification that someone commented on your social media post, that’s likely powered by a webhook. The application sends the data to your device in real time, eliminating the need for you to refresh the page or manually check for updates.
Webhooks first gained traction in the mid-2000s as developers sought more efficient ways to connect applications. At the time, APIs were the dominant method for data exchange, but they came with limitations. Polling APIs for updates was resource-heavy and often resulted in unnecessary server load and latency.
The concept of webhooks was introduced as a lightweight alternative. By allowing applications to "subscribe" to specific events and receive updates only when those events occurred, webhooks offered a more streamlined approach. Early adopters, such as GitHub, recognized the potential of webhooks and began incorporating them into their platforms, paving the way for broader adoption.

Despite their many benefits, webhooks are not without challenges. Security is a primary concern, as webhooks rely on public URLs to deliver data. Without proper authentication and encryption, they can be vulnerable to attacks such as spoofing or unauthorized access.
Additionally, managing webhooks at scale can be complex. Developers must account for issues like retries, rate limits, and error handling to ensure reliable delivery. Fortunately, advancements in webhook management tools and best practices have made it easier to address these challenges.
